Analysis of asphaltenes adsorption on surfaces using QCM-D
The adsorption of asphaltenes in crude oil to different surfaces represents an important issue for the petrochemical industry. QCM-D technology can be used to evaluate different approaches to solve such problems. In particular, the ability of QCM-D technology to monitor various structural arrangements of adsorbed materials can be used to understand how asphaltenes adsorb to surfaces.
In this application note:
Asphaltene adsorption under various conditions has been analyzed and quantified. The note includes asphaltene–surface interaction results for:
-
Different hydrophilic surface materials (e.g. SiO₂, Al₂O₃, TiOₓ, FeOₓ)
-
Asphaltenes from different crude oil origins
-
Solvent conditions with varying asphaltene stability (e.g. toluene, heptane/toluene mixtures)
